How Chiropractic Care Can Help Treat Sciatica

Chiropractic care is a natural, non-invasive approach to managing pain. Chiropractors use a variety of techniques to reduce pain and improve movement, such as spinal manipulation, soft tissue therapy, and rehabilitative exercises. These techniques can help reduce inflammation and pressure on the sciatic nerve, which can relieve pain and improve function.

Spinal manipulation is a common technique used by chiropractors to reduce pain and improve movement. Spinal manipulation involves applying a gentle, controlled force to the spine to restore proper alignment and movement. This can help reduce inflammation and pressure on the sciatic nerve, which can reduce pain and improve mobility.
